
Ingredients
- 4 cans (300 ml) condense milk
- 2 cups sweetened macapuno (desiccated coconut) preserves
- 1 cup na cornstarch
- ¼ cup of water
Procedure
- Place the condensada in the filler and cook in a weak fire until it becomes thick.
- Remove into the fire, put in a cornstarch (melted in 1/4 glass of water)
- Mix ingredients thoroughly and mix well.
- Cook until it is slightly thick and does not stick to the pan. refrigerate the refrigerator.
- Apply it round shape and place in white sugar.
- I wrap it in cellophane to make it more presentable when it is eaten or sold to others.
